LawyerForTickets.com





Supriya of New York, NY February 10, 2009


I consulted with Mr. Mitchell P on the phone to defend a speeding ticket I had received. He markets himslef as a lawyer for tickets (lawyerfortickets.com). He assured me that he would try to get the ticket dismissed but if that was not possible he would ask for a point reduction. I entrusted him in defending me in court but when the day arrived Mr. P did not even try to defend me. He went straight for the point reduction. He did not cross examine the poilice officer at all. He did not ask any questions what so ever. HE did not even make a statement to the Judge regrading what happend. He went straight for the point redution. I felt he violated the trust I gave him in defending me. I felt as if he went for the shortest route in resolving the case rather then what was in the best interst of me the client. I would hate for this to happend to anybody else.

Since Mr. P went straight for the point redution there was no chance at all for the ticket to be dismissed. When I spoke to him regarding how he handled the case he said given the judge that was there that was the best way to handle the case becasue the officers testimony left no room for inquiry. If he is not capapble of cross examining the officer in a way that defends me then he should have been upfron with me and said that in the first place. He should not have stated that he would try to get the case dismissed when he had no intention of doing so.

The officers testimonies are rote memorization and I am sure he deals with them all the time. He should have been prepared. I would have found someone else that was capable of defending me properly. Also, If he felt that the judge is very stern then maybe he should have advised me to reschedule the case. I now have a tarnished driving record without a fight that I paid him for. This should not happen to anybody else and thus am writing to you.
